The using of the instrumental methods of skin thickness measurement for the diagnosis of inflammatory breast cancer

https://doi.org/10.18027/2224-5057-2015-4-24-27

Abstract

The substance of the skin in 100 patients with inflammatory breast cancer was studied. Diagnosed skin thickening more than 2,5–3 mm compared with a symmety part of an opposite breast. The average thickness of the skin cancer edema is 5,6 mm and maximum one is 14 mm. The sensitivity of the digital mammography and sonography was 97%, of plikometry – 94%. Digitally instrumental determination of skin thickness using radiodiagnostic methods and by plikometry is precise and objective method of diagnostic of breast cancer edema.
